Default Turbo 2000

just noticed most people on here have the Turbo 2000 can some one explain what is so special about them over the Type R/RA ?

Default

Turbo 2000 is a UK spec WRX.
Type R / RA is a JDM Spec and more sought after car.

The Turbo 2000 was the official top of the range UK Impreza up to the bugeye arriving in 2001.

While not as fast as an STI it is still a good car with a few choice mods and they are cheap as chips.

They are what 99% of people bought, until the bugeye, because until then, the STi variants were ONLY available as a grey import, and dealers were encouraged to refuse service, parts etc etc.
